Job Summary
Are you a Housing/Homeless Services professional looking for an opportunity to manage a dynamic team within an emerging City? If so, the City of San Bernardino invites you to apply to be the next Housing Division Manager (U).
The Position:
The Housing Division Manager (U) manages, supervises and coordinates the functions of the Housing Division within the Community & Economic Development Department. This position will be assigned to manage Homeless Programs and will will provide guidance on homeless issues and the City's efforts to address and reduce homelessness.
The Ideal Candidate:
The ideal candidate for the position of Housing Division Manager will bring a wealth of experience and expertise to successfully fulfill the outlined key functions. The candidate will effectively collaborate with the Deputy Director of Housing & Homelessness to lead a dynamic development team, managing staff, consultants, architects, engineers, and contractors. Their proven ability to negotiate contracts, prepare comprehensive staff reports, and deliver compelling Council presentations will be crucial in advancing the organization's goals.
Furthermore, the ideal candidate will demonstrate proficiency in overseeing the entire lifecycle of affordable housing development, from initial site research and land acquisition to feasibility analysis, pre-development, design, project financing, construction, and loan close-out. Their commitment to ensuring compliance with federal regulations related to labor, environmental concerns, employment, procurement, and program execution will be evident in their track record of obtaining federal funding clearance for each development activity.
The ideal candidate will also be adept at managing Owner Occupied Housing Rehabilitation and Infill Housing Programs, showcasing a comprehensive understanding of the intricacies involved. Collaborating with legal counsel and HUD representatives, the candidate will excel in creating exemplar CDBG and ESG subrecipient agreements that align with HUD standards.
In addition, the candidate will bring a strategic perspective to the role, overseeing HOME and NSP affordable housing activities and providing valuable input on related policies and procedures. Their ability to collaborate in the preparation of State and Federal reports, such as PLHA, Annual Action Plan, CAPERS, etc., will further contribute to the organization's success. Overall, the ideal candidate will be a seasoned professional with a proven track record in affordable housing development, regulatory compliance, and effective collaboration with diverse stakeholders.
About the City:
The City of San Bernardino is a community rich in history and cultural diversity. Influences of Native Americans, Mexican settlers, and Spanish missionaries can still be seen throughout the City today. From 1810 to the present, San Bernardino has been recognized for its scenic beauty and strategic location. Today, the City of San Bernardino serves as the county seat and is the largest city in the County of San Bernardino with a population of 214,706.

Minimum Qualifications
Education, Training and Experience:
Possession of a Bachelor's Degree from an accredited college or university with major coursework in public administration, business administration, finance, economics or a related field;
AND
five (5) years of progressively responsible experience in community development and home funds initiatives, including responsibility for grant applications and administration of grant awards, at least two (2) years of which were in a supervisory capacity; or an equivalent combination of training and experience.
A Master's Degree is highly desirable.
Licenses; Certificates; Special Requirements:
A valid California driver's license and the ability to maintain insurability under the City's vehicle insurance policy.

Health Insurance - Eligible to receive a City contribution of $1,125.00 or $1,724.00 to help offset health, dental and vision premiums. Eligible employees who waive all medical, dental, vision, supplemental life, and supplemental AD&D benefits will recieve an annual "Health Insurance Waiver Stipend" of $3,500.00 every first paycheck of December.
Retirement for Current Members - For employees hired after 1/1/2013 who are current members of California Public Employees' Retirement System (CalPERS) or a reciprocal agency as of 12/31/12 and have not been separated from service from such agency for six months or more, the retirement benefit shall be 2% @ 55; highest single year of compensation.
Retirement for New Members - For employees hired 1/1/2013 or later and who are not a member of the California Public Employees' Retirement System (CalPERS) or a reciprocal agency as of 12/31/12, or those who have been separated from a public agency which contracts with CalPERS or a reciprocal agency for six months or more, the retirement benefit shall be 2% @ 62; 3 year final compensation. New members will be obligated to pay 50% of the "normal cost" of their retirement benefits as required by State law.
